From 3de1fa67869b3f7301b83eed71dba28075d41bc1 Mon Sep 17 00:00:00 2001 From: saces Date: Fri, 20 Feb 2026 19:24:15 +0100 Subject: [PATCH] temp woodpeckerhack --- compose.yaml |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/compose.yaml b/compose.yaml index a7253bd..cb9e596 100644 --- a/compose.yaml +++ b/compose.yaml @@ -53,7 +53,18 @@ services: pull: true dockerfile_inline: | # syntax=docker/dockerfile:1 + FROM docker.io/golang:1.26 AS gobuild + + WORKDIR /woodpeckerhack + + RUN git clone -b cli-exec-matrix https://codeberg.org/saces/woodpecker.git . + RUN --mount=type=cache,target=/root/.cache/go-build \ + --mount=type=cache,target=/go/pkg \ + make build-cli + FROM docker.io/woodpeckerci/woodpecker-cli:next-alpine + COPY --from=gobuild /woodpeckerhack/dist/woodpecker-cli /bin/ + USER root RUN <